Our History: Embedded in the Medical University Hospital Graz
NoTube and its services are based on a long tradition of medical expertise derived from research and work experience by the interdisciplinary team of the University Children’s Hospital Graz. At this clinic, the 3-week intensive tube weaning approach called “The Graz Model” has been developed, presented, published and evaluated. It is also at this Hospital at the psychosomatic division, that the In-/Outpatient treatment takes place.
The University Hospital Graz
The University Hospital Graz was founded in 1788 and currently provides over 1500 beds. A close link between clinical work and the research and teaching conducted at the Medical University Graz has been implemented from the beginning and is much appreciated by patients. The Medical University Graz is a teaching and research centre of international reputation for thousands of students, research fellows and teachers. 3 Researchers from the Medical University have been awarded the Nobel Prize.
The Psychosomatic Division
Our senior medical experts continue to work at the Psychosomatic Unit of the Pediatric Department. It was founded in 1981 and specializes on the increasing cases of feeding and eating behavior disorders in early childhood and adolescence, for which specific programs have been developed.
It is equipped with:
- 8 beds
- 4 parent-child-units
- A team of pediatric specialists of all sub disciplines, radiologists, surgeons, nutritionists, psychologists, psychotherapists, speech therapists, occupational therapists, physiotherapists, teachers, early interventionists, social workers, dedicated medical trainees as well as specifically trained nursing staff.
24/7 medical support is available in German or English. Communication is also possible in French and Italian and interpreters for any other language can be provided.
